Key Norwegian Cruise Line Phone Numbers for Travel Agents

While the NCL website prominently displays customer service numbers for general inquiries, there are dedicated lines specifically for travel agents and trade partners. Norwegian Cruise Line Phone Numbers for Travel Agents

1. Travel Agent Reduced-Rate Cruises

  • Phone: 800-281-4382
    This is the go-to line for travel agents looking to access agent-exclusive, reduced-rate cruise bookings.

2. Agency Maintenance (New Agencies / Updates)

  • Phone: 877-625-7471 (also used for fax)
    Use this line to set up a new agency with NCL or to update existing agency contact information.

3. Specialized Departments for Travel Agents

The "Travel Partner Reference Guide" also lists other relevant lines:

  • Universal Reservations (fits Individual or FIT bookings): 800-327-7030, press #1 for existing bookings, #2 for new bookings.

  • Group Administration, for groups of 40+: same 800-327-7030 number on pressing #2.

  • Shore Excursions: 866-625-1167, or shoreex@ncl.com

  • Payment Services (commissions, refunds): 866-625-9177, PaymentServices@ncl.com

  • Premium Air (flight adjustments, air/sea bookings): 866-635-1163, premiumair@ncl.com

  • CruiseNext (handling future cruise certificate inquiries): 866-254-7352, CruiseNext@ncl.com

  • Guest Relations (post-cruise issues): 866-625-1164

  • Automation Support (technical support, booking website issues): 866-625-1160, ncladmin@ncl.com

Why These Lines Matter for Travel Agents

Simply put, as a travel professional, these contacts unlock better access, personalized service, and exclusive perks:

  • Discounted Rates: Agents accessing the travel agent line often unlock reduced-rate fares not available to the general public.

  • Faster Service & Prioritization: Departments like Group Admin or Payment Services streamline agent-driven queries and bookings.

  • Support for Complex Requests: Handling last-minute flight changes, group dining, shore excursions, or commission discrepancies is much smoother when routed through the correct department.

  • Dedicated Tools & Self-Service: Tools like Norwegian Central (agent portal) offer streamlined resource access—once your agency is set up.

Best Practices:

  • Have key booking details on hand: reservation number, guest names, sailing date, booking type.

  • Clearly specify your role as a travel agent to ensure priority routing.

  • Use agency-exclusive lines first for better wait times and agent-level support.

  • For group or special event bookings, don’t hesitate to call Group Admin early to lock in details.

  • Always note date and time, whom you spoke with, and keep follow-up emails for record-keeping.

Accessing the “Norwegian Central” Agent Portal

Many travel agents prefer using NCL’s agent portal—Norwegian Central—as their booking and support hub.

  • Access: Available at the NCL travel partner portal link (as shown in search results).

  • Capabilities: Agents can learn, promote, and book NCL cruises directly in the portal.

  • Registration: Requires agency admin credentials; new agencies can register via the Agency Admin Registration form, but must contact newagency@ncl.com for guidance.

** Tip**: Internal access saves time and grants real-time inventory, promotional codes, and agent tools—making it more efficient than phone for routine bookings.
